Overview

Postcode PO12 2AB is located in an urban city, within the Anglesey ward of Gosport in the South East region, and forms part of the Clayhall & Anglesey area. It has low deprivation and very low crime levels, with around 19.9 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 76% below the South East average of 84 per 1,000. The average income per household in Clayhall & Anglesey is £61,092 per year. The nearest station is Portsmouth Harbour, about 0.9 miles away. There are 3 primary and no secondary schools in the area. There is 1 park nearby, the closest large park is Walpole Park.
